Symptoms

  • •Check engine light illuminated
  • •Rough engine idle
  • •Loss of power during acceleration
  • •Increased fuel consumption
  • •Engine stalling or hesitation
  • •Unusual exhaust emissions (e.g., black smoke)

Solution
1. Preparation
  • Gather necessary tools and components.
  • Disconnect the battery to ensure safety.
  • Allow the engine to cool before starting work.
2. Replace Spark Plugs
  • Sub-steps:
    1. Remove the ignition coil from the misfiring cylinder by unscrewing the retaining bolts.
    2. Disconnect the electrical connector from the ignition coil.
    3. Use a spark plug socket to carefully remove the old spark plug.
    4. Inspect the spark plug for wear; replace it with a new one if necessary.
    5. Torque the new spark plug to the manufacturer’s specifications (usually around 13-15 lb-ft).
    6. Reattach the ignition coil and reconnect the electrical connector.
3. Inspect and Replace Ignition Coils
  • Sub-steps:
    1. Remove the ignition coil(s) for the affected cylinder(s) as described above.
    2. Visually inspect the coils for cracks or carbon tracking.
    3. Replace any faulty ignition coils with new components.
    4. Reinstall the ignition coils and ensure secure connections.
4. Fuel Injector Cleaning/Replacement
  • Sub-steps:
    1. Remove the fuel rail to access the fuel injectors.
    2. Disconnect the electrical connectors from the fuel injectors.
    3. Remove the injectors from the fuel rail and inspect for clogs.
    4. Clean the injectors or replace them if necessary.
    5. Reinstall the injectors and ensure all connections are tight.
5. Check for Vacuum Leaks
  • Sub-steps:
    1. Inspect all vacuum lines for cracks or disconnections.
    2. Use a smoke machine or carburetor cleaner to identify leaks around the intake manifold.
    3. Replace any damaged vacuum hoses and tighten connections.
